As I arrived home today, 25 or so WW crossbills were feeding in the cone
crop at the very top of a Norway Spruce in my yard, completely ignoring
the hemlocks.  My house is maybe 2000 yards from the Harriet Keeler
woods in Brecksville Reservation.

Interestingly, last year or two years ago I found white winged
crossbills in the UP, and  up there they were singing, which was
(obviously) quite different from the call notes I heard in the yard today.
